On Mon, Aug 28, 2017 at 12:04 PM, Jorge . <chocolate.camera at gmail.com> wrote:
> Validator.nu (X)HTML5 Validator at https://html5.validator.nu
> validates only HTML5, not XHTML5, despite its name, when attempting to
> do so via direct input (Text Field).
>
> Tested with this markup:
>
> <?xml version="1.0" encoding="UTF-8"?>
> <!DOCTYPE html>
> <html xmlns="http://www.w3.org/1999/xhtml">
>    <head>
>       <meta charset="UTF-8"/>
>       <title>My title</title>
>    </head>
>    <body>
>    </body>
> </html>
>
> The submission form does not have an option to forcibly request XHTML5
> validation instead of HTML5. Even when the markup is preceded by the
> XML declaration (which nevertheless is purportedly not necessary if
> contents are UTF-8), the validator reports the very declaration as an
> error:
>
>> Error: Saw <?. Probable cause: Attempt to use an XML processing instruction in HTML. (XML processing instructions are not supported in HTML.)
>
> revealing that even with such markup it is validating HTML5 instead of XHTML5.
>
> The generic validator at https://validator.nu used to have a preset or
> parser (cannot remember) specifically for XHTML5, but not anymore
> either it seems.
